|
POST
|
I'm glad that works. Are you specifying "returnPopupsOnly == true" in your "Identify" operation? I'm not sure that makes a difference, but it would be good to know. Also, when I load the layer into a ArcGIS.com map, I see there are three different county layers. All of them look like they have more attributes that what you're seeing, however. Make sure you have the correct one. I couldn't find a way (yet) to programmatically specify which fields are returned for an Identify operation, but I will keep digging and keep you posted. Mark
... View more
04-16-2018
09:50 AM
|
0
|
5
|
1992
|
|
POST
|
Todd, Than you for your question! The most likely scenario is that you are getting results, but they are located in the sublayerResults property of the AGSIdentifyLayerResult object passed to you from the identify completion handler. Note that elements in the sublayerResults array property are also of type AGSIdentifyLayerResult, so they may have objects in their sublayerResults array as well. If you are interested in only identifying layers in your AGSArcGISMapImageLayer, you can use one of the identify methods on AGSGeoView which takes a specific layer, like this one: -(id<AGSCancelable>)identifyLayer:(AGSLayer*)layer screenPoint:(CGPoint)screenPoint tolerance:(double)tolerance returnPopupsOnly:(BOOL)returnPopupsOnly maximumResults:(NSInteger)maximumResults completion:(void(^)(AGSIdentifyLayerResult *identifyResult))completion; If you are not finding your results in the sublayerResults array, let me know and we can dig into it further. Mark
... View more
04-16-2018
08:36 AM
|
2
|
7
|
1992
|
|
POST
|
Jake, Can you send me a complete call stack with all the threads? That should help us debug it. Thanks, Mark
... View more
04-12-2018
11:52 AM
|
0
|
1
|
494
|
|
POST
|
Jake, Can you try setting the AGSGeoView.isAttributionTextVisible property to false? This will hide the attribution text view and should prevent the issue from happening. We are continuing to debug the issue here to see if there's a permanent fix. Mark
... View more
04-12-2018
05:47 AM
|
0
|
3
|
1761
|
|
POST
|
> Is there a tool to visualize extents given a spatial reference? We don't provide a specific API/method to do this, but you can accomplish this by adding an `AGSGraphicOverlay` to the mapView and then adding a new graphic (with a fill symbol) with the extent you want to visualize to the overlay. That would display the extent in question on the map. You could also add an attribute to the graphic describing the extent, so that when tapped on (and retrieved via an identify operation), you could display information about the extent. > Can you give me an example of how to limit labels to a specific extent in an ArcGIS map? I will need to research this and get back to you. Mark
... View more
04-06-2018
12:45 PM
|
0
|
0
|
1406
|
|
POST
|
Excellent, glad you got it working! If you have any more questions, please let me know. Mark
... View more
04-06-2018
11:09 AM
|
0
|
0
|
903
|
|
POST
|
Thank you for your question! Are you using the SDK's `AGSPopupsViewController` class to display your popups? If so, that will handle displaying full-size images from the attachments. You can look at the following sample for an example of how to use `AGSPopupsViewController`: arcgis-runtime-samples-ios/EditFeaturesOnlineViewController.swift at master · Esri/arcgis-runtime-samples-ios · GitHub You can also download the sample application from the App Store or download the GitHub repo and build/run it locally to see how it works. If you are writing you're own popup viewer, you can either fetch and load the attachments using the `AGSArcGISFeature.fetchAttachmentsWithCompletion` method or use the `AGSPopupAttachmentManager` and `AGSPopupAttachment` classes to handle a lot of the work for you. Once you have the attachment image you would display that in a new `UIImageView`. Let me know if that doesn't answer your question or you need more info, Mark
... View more
04-05-2018
02:12 PM
|
1
|
2
|
903
|
|
POST
|
Marc, I opened up the Seattle Parking Map on an iPhone 8 and at similar zoom levels the labels looked the same as in a test app build with the SDK and in ArcGIS.com (in Safari). So I don't think there's any difference with how those three are displaying the labels. I do not know of a way to increase just the label size, aside from creating a new data set with bigger labels. If you want to use a third party service for data/labels, take a look at this Sample we provide on GitHub: arcgis-runtime-samples-ios/arcgis-ios-sdk-samples/Layers/Web tiled layer at master · Esri/arcgis-runtime-samples-ios · G… It describes the `AGSWebTiledLayer` and "provides a simple way to integrate non-ArcGIS Services as a layer in a map." It should answer your questions about levels-of-detail. >> A) Obviously there labels are worldwide, while my map data is only for the state of Washington. Is there any way to restrict the drawing of the labels to a specific extent? The map will display the entire extent of your base map; if your base map has a limited extent (say the state of Washington), that should limit the map extent to that. Depending on the data, you might be able to perform a spatial query, only returning data in a given extent (the state of Washington). Again, if you create a new dataset with larger labels, you would limit the labels shown that way. >> C) Is it possible to get a vector based label layer from ArcGIS? AGSBasemap imageryWithLabelsVectorBasemap obviously has a AGSArcGISVectorTiledLayer reference layer AGSBasemap has both "reference layers" and "base layers". Both of those are arrays of AGSLayer objects, which has an `isVisible` property you can use to control the visibility. I'm not aware of any layers specific to just labels that we provide. Mark
... View more
03-27-2018
12:57 PM
|
0
|
2
|
1406
|
|
POST
|
Marc, I can see that at that zoom level the labels are pretty small. For comparison, I ran a test app with your data on an iPhone 8 and also loaded a map with the same labels in Safari on the same iPhone 8. The results are almost identical, so I don't think there's an issue with DPI on Retina displays. With the 100.x releases we are basically interpreting DIPs the same way that the browser does. That’s the justification for the change from the 100.2.5 behavior. Safari - ArcGIS.com map viewer Test app using Runtime SDK for iOS - iPhone 8 Let us know if there's anything else we can help with. Mark
... View more
03-23-2018
01:58 PM
|
0
|
4
|
1406
|
|
POST
|
Jake, one more question: Is this in a mapView or sceneView? Thanks.
... View more
03-22-2018
01:42 PM
|
0
|
6
|
1761
|
|
POST
|
Jake, Thanks for the info. It looks like it might be a problem on our end, but I'll keep you posted, especially if I can find a work-around. Mark
... View more
03-22-2018
01:41 PM
|
0
|
7
|
1761
|
|
POST
|
Marc, Sorry to hear you're having problems. I tested this here, in the iPhone 8 simulator and on a device, and compared those images to the same data in the ArcGIS.com Map Viewer in Safari. The results were very similar; the highway shields on the iPhone were slightly smaller that AGOL, but not by much. An image comparing the two is below. What device(s) and iOS versions are you seeing the difference on? How does it appear in the simulator? Is it a slight (~10% difference) or a 2x - 3x difference? With the 100.x releases, there is no need for the 10.2.x `renderNativeResolution` property, as the resolutions and DPIs are now all handled internally and automatically. Mark
... View more
03-22-2018
01:18 PM
|
0
|
0
|
1406
|
|
POST
|
Hello, and thank you for your question. The token based licensing in 10.2.x is the same as the licensing your app with a named user in 100.x. See the new licensing doc here: License your app—ArcGIS Runtime SDK for iOS | ArcGIS for Developers Look for the section "License your app with a Named User account". If you have any more questions, please let us know. Mark
... View more
03-21-2018
03:34 PM
|
0
|
2
|
1013
|
|
POST
|
Shimin, Excellent. Let us know if there's anything else we can help with. I'm going to forward your feedback about the guide documentation to the appropriate people. Thanks, Mark
... View more
03-21-2018
10:12 AM
|
0
|
3
|
1206
|
|
POST
|
Thank you for the additional information. I'm going to do some research on my end. Mark
... View more
03-20-2018
12:18 PM
|
0
|
9
|
1761
|
| Title | Kudos | Posted |
|---|---|---|
| 1 | 07-30-2025 09:41 AM | |
| 2 | 11-25-2024 01:58 PM | |
| 2 | 08-19-2024 02:33 PM | |
| 1 | 05-31-2023 09:26 AM | |
| 1 | 04-19-2023 08:58 AM |
| Online Status |
Offline
|
| Date Last Visited |
08-18-2025
09:06 AM
|